The Tandem Health Interview Loop

Your onsite loop will typically consist of 4 rounds.

  1. 1

    Round 1

    Recruiter Screen
    Motivation, customer-facing experience, fit with the segment (SMB / Mid-market / Enterprise).
  2. 2

    Round 2

    Customer Story
    Walking through how you saved an at-risk account, drove adoption, or expanded a customer.
  3. 3

    Round 3

    Renewal & Expansion
    QBR roleplay, identifying expansion signals, navigating churn risk, multi-stakeholder alignment.
  4. 4

    Round 4

    QBR Roleplay
    Live mock QBR - presenting health metrics, ROI evidence, and renewal/expansion narrative to a customer panel.
  5. 5

    Round 5

    Behavioral / Leadership
    Past evidence of ownership, influence, resolving conflict.

The Danger Zone: Top Reasons Candidates Fail

Based on our database of Tandem Health interview outcomes, avoid these common traps:

  • Blaming the customer's IT department or EHR vendor publicly instead of taking cross-functional ownership
  • Delivering a generic feature dump instead of tying the expansion feature to specific operational bottlenecks
  • Relying on legacy relationships without securing documented organizational support across multiple departments
  • Attempting to scale rapidly without setting clear performance indicators during the pilot phase
